Shilpa Shetty buys stake in Gourmet Group
August 27th, 2009 - 11:13 pm ICT by Sampurn Wire
Actress, Shilpa Shetty and her fiancé, entrepreneur Raj Kundra announced a 33 percent stake in V8 Gourmet Group. V8 is an international Indian food company valued at GBP 20 million and encompasses The Bombay Bicycle Club Kitchens, Tiffinbites, Vama and Gourmet Creations brands.
The GBP 6 million investments will be used to expand the company’s successful Bombay Bicycle Club Kitchens delivery service, which currently has 15 Delivery Kitchens in the UK. It will also enable the company to expand the Tiffinbites restaurants, concessions and franchises in London and abroad. Global expansion for V8 includes the opening of two Tiffinbites casual dining and shopping mall dining formats in Dubai (October 2009) and Jordan (March 2010).
“I feel proud to be associated with the V8 Group. They have carved a niche for themselves in the Indian food industry in the last 13 years, and spell consistency, quality and authentic Indian food. I know that our partnership will grow and envisage a great future with a whole new line of products and restaurants all over Europe, Dubai and Jordan,” stated Shilpa Shetty.
The investment will also see the launch of Ms Shetty’s Gourmet Creations Range of premium authentic gourmet meals, chutneys and pickles. The range will initially be North Indian and will later offer tastes of Shilpa’s mother tongue region.
Mr Kundra has a diverse portfolio of international investments and is also owner of a cricket team and concrete production company in the Ukraine.
